    The university and admissions department would have to allow players to transfer in who wouldn't be on track to graduate in 4 years. And basically the only way you can transfer in and still be on track to graduate on time is if you're taking the same classes at [insert other school here] as you would be taking at ND. Which means that to transfer into ND you have to plan your class schedule around what ND wants, not what the requirements for your current major at your current school are.
